It's my endocrinologist, unfortunately, that will not do the scan for the parathyroid condition. I have even offered to have it billed directly and not sent through insurance just to get them to do it already. If it found something, then we could file it and the insurance would really have no choice but to pay for the test. If not, I would shut up about the whole thing and pay off the bill. It is a simple scan, nonevasive aside from injecting some dye. My endo is stating that the parathyroid issue is secondary to the vitamin D deficiency and if we corrected the deficiency, the parathyroids would go back to normal. Some of my research suggests otherwise. I am going to continue to ask for/demand this test until she finally cracks. I swear it really shouldn't be this hard.
